PMB2314

Prescaler Circuit 2.1 GHz

Functional Description/ Application The IC is designed for use in mobile radio communication devices up to 2100 MHz and upconversion systems up 2500 MHz. Due to low power consumption and low phase noise generation, the PMB2314T is suitable for use in battery powered handheld systems, e.g. GSM, c
